Problems during tuning
8. No peaks obtained (peaks extremely small) (cont.)
Check the ion source.
□ Is the ion source correctly installed?
Check if the ion source was distorted during installation.
□ Is any foreign matter inside the ion source?
Check inside the ion source for foreign matter, such as fragments of broken column.
□ Is the column length appropriate?
Normal ionization is not possible if the column is inserted too far into the ion source.
Check the RF power supply.
□ Are the RF GAIN and RF OFFSET values appropriate?
If no peaks are obtained, reduce the RF OFFSET value to about 4000.
This reduces the resolution but makes peaks easier to detect.
□ Is the RF power supply operating normally?
See section 4.11 RF PS Assy for details about how to check the RF power supply
operation.
Check the signal detection.
□ Does a small amount of noise appear in the peak monitor window when the
preamplifier is
tapped?
View the peak monitor at 999x zoom.
If no noise appears, check the detector wiring and the connections between the
preamplifier and CPU-A.
